What is the maximum sentence for a Class Y Felony?

The maximum sentence for a Class Y Felony is indeed 40 years. Class Y Felonies are among the most serious offenses within the classification of felonies, reflecting significant severity in the legal system. This level of felony typically encompasses violent crimes or crimes that could result in substantial harm to individuals or society.

Statutory guidelines set forth by state law determine the length of sentences for felonies, and Class Y Felonies are designated to have a more severe penalty range compared to lower classifications. Understanding the implications of such convictions, including the lengthy potential sentences, is critical for law enforcement officers as they handle cases involving serious crimes.
